Transaction abd6cbd37b110cce2deca9133bd0752fbdcfeee9b96dbb63054e4223a25f6096
1 Input
2 Outputs
- abd6cbd37b110cce2deca9133bd0752fbdcfeee9b96dbb63054e4223a25f6096:0
- abd6cbd37b110cce2deca9133bd0752fbdcfeee9b96dbb63054e4223a25f6096:1
value 418894
address 1FVMH8d4knsGoVda2k9957DbXdgXoLXsPe
value 2674978
address 1FF2KeYEFLwj7zVSSz6CdwZm862W1CPhma